Energy Efficiency and Reduced Carbon Footprint


One of the most compelling environmental benefits of using small character inkjet printers lies in their impressive energy efficiency. Unlike many traditional printing technologies that require substantial amounts of power to operate, small character inkjet printers typically consume significantly less electricity. This energy-saving performance directly translates into a smaller carbon footprint. In an era where reducing greenhouse gas emissions is critical, using low-energy devices within industrial and commercial settings becomes invaluable.


Small character inkjet printers are designed to use energy optimally, often incorporating advanced power management features such as automatic sleep modes or energy-conscious startup sequences. These innovations help minimize unnecessary power usage. Additionally, the compact size of these printers often means they require fewer raw materials and less energy during manufacturing, which further reduces their overall environmental impact.


From an operational perspective, these printers often run on minimal power without sacrificing performance. This balance between efficiency and output is especially vital in industries where printing is continuous, such as packaging or product labeling. The cumulative energy savings from adopting numerous energy-efficient printers across organizations can be substantial, contributing to global efforts toward sustainable energy consumption. This, coupled with the fact that smaller devices take up less manufacturing resources and require less transportation fuel to be distributed, firmly positions small character inkjet printers as a preferable eco-friendly alternative.


Minimization of Consumables and Waste


Another significant environmental advantage of small character inkjet printers is their capacity to minimize the use of consumables, which reduces waste generation. Traditional printing methods often rely on large amounts of paper, labels, ribbons, or cartridges that, once used, become waste requiring proper disposal. Small character inkjet printers, however, are engineered to deliver clear and precise printing without the need for bulky materials like ribbons or excess packaging.


Their technology focuses on applying ink directly to surfaces using tiny droplets, reducing excessive ink consumption and eliminating the necessity for additional printing media. This approach not only trims operational costs but also markedly reduces the volume of waste produced. Since ink usage is highly controlled and optimized in these printers, the amount of unused or discarded ink is decreased, which is beneficial both economically and environmentally.


Furthermore, many manufacturers have started formulating eco-friendly and biodegradable inks for these devices. These inks break down more easily in the environment, decreasing the risk of long-term soil and water contamination. An associated benefit stems from fewer replacement parts being required due to the durable and efficient design of small character inkjet printers. This durability means fewer disposed printers and components entering the waste stream, lessening landfill pressures.


By decreasing the frequency and volume of consumables needed, these printers support a more sustainable approach to printing processes. Businesses adopting small character inkjet printers often find themselves contributing to waste reduction efforts passively, which can be a critical step in improving resource management and environmental responsibility.

Reduction of Hazardous Substances


One of the environmental challenges associated with printing technologies is the use of hazardous chemicals and substances that can pose risks to both human health and ecosystems. Small character inkjet printers have contributed to alleviating some of these concerns by adopting safer ink formulations and materials.


Many of these printers utilize water-based or solvent-free inks, which reduce the emission of volatile organic compounds (VOCs) into the atmosphere. VOCs contribute to air pollution and can have harmful effects on respiratory health. By limiting the release of VOCs, small character inkjet printers promote safer indoor air quality for workers and consumers.


Moreover, the shift toward non-toxic, biodegradable, and environmentally friendly inks has gained traction in the industry. These inks are designed to break down naturally after disposal, reducing the accumulation of toxic residues in landfills and aquatic environments. The avoidance of heavy metals and other hazardous additives in printer inks further mitigates risks associated with environmental contamination.


Additionally, small character inkjet printers often produce less physical waste that might require special handling or treatment, such as spent ribbons or toners laden with harmful substances. This reduction in hazardous waste simplifies disposal processes and lowers environmental liabilities for companies using these technologies.


In summary, by transitioning to safer chemicals and sustainable inks, small character inkjet printers provide a practical solution for reducing the environmental and health hazards traditionally linked to printing activities.


Versatility and its Role in Promoting Eco-Friendly Practices


The versatility of small character inkjet printers extends their environmental benefits beyond mere energy and resource savings. These printers are adaptable across numerous industries, including food and beverage, pharmaceuticals, electronics, and logistics, allowing for more sustainable operational practices.


Because small character inkjet printers can directly print on various substrates—such as plastics, glass, paper, and metal—they eliminate the need for additional labels or adhesives, which are often waste-intensive to produce and dispose of. Direct printing means reduced material use, lowered packaging waste, and enhanced recyclability of the product packaging.


Furthermore, these printers support on-demand printing, which reduces overproduction and the throwing away of preprinted materials that may become obsolete. This capability helps companies reduce inventory waste and improve supply chain efficiency, both of which have positive environmental repercussions.


The adaptability of these printers also encourages companies to integrate sustainability criteria into their processes without sacrificing quality or throughput. By enabling clear product coding, lot tracking, and expiration markings in a green manner, small character inkjet printers help companies adhere to regulatory and environmental standards, promoting consumer safety and environmental stewardship simultaneously.


In essence, the multifunctional nature of small character inkjet printers makes them a valuable tool in the broad movement toward sustainable industrial and commercial practices.
